Onboarding — Brambledocs role-based access, notes for the weekly eng sync. Brambledocs assigns each space one of three roles: reader, contributor, or steward. Stewards manage page permissions and can restore deleted revisions; contributors edit but cannot change access rules. New engineers start as readers everywhere and are promoted per space by their team's steward. If all stewards for a space are unavailable, the recovery console grants temporary stewardship. That console authenticates with the passphrase provided below.

vault phrase of tajef-tafog = istox-sorax-zorox-casok-holox-kelix-weneth-drueth-casion

**TKT-4471: Expired trace-collector credential**

Spans from the Quillback checkout services stopped reaching the Fernline trace aggregator at 03:10. Root cause: the collector's service credential expired; rotation job was disabled last sprint. Traces are dropping silently, so cross-service request correlation is broken. Rotation re-enabled. Interim fix applied to the collector config with the replacement key below.

service key, kaduf-bawig: kto15_Ze79S0dligTw0yO

TICKET-2214: Fan-out backpressure stalls notifications

Severity: high. Component: Hollyvane notifier.

Repro:
1. Seed 50k subscribers on a test topic.
2. Publish 200 events/s for two minutes.
3. Observe fan-out workers queue past the high-water mark; delivery latency climbs above 90s and never recovers.

Expected: backpressure sheds load gracefully. Actual: workers block on the slowest push channel.

New folks: reproduce in the perf sandbox only, never prod. The load script needs auth against the sandbox gateway; use the bearer token below.

session JWT of yawep-yawep = eyJhbGciOiJIUzI1NiIsInR5cCI6IkpXVCJ9.eyJzdWIiOiI3pWF3_In0.aXYsHiog

### Escalation

If the Binwhistle pick-list optimizer starts spitting out routes longer than the baseline by 15% or more, don't wait it out — flip the `legacy-pather` flag and note it in the release log. That buys us time without blocking the rollout. If the flag doesn't help within an hour, escalate to the optimizer crew directly.

escalation mailbox, yajog-kahag: holmir_olimir@lumicsys.corp